Sorted by channel: Pressure Pressure channel sorted according to values in sort channel $END *COMMENTS Analysis methods: ----------------- Salinity samples are collected in glass bottles and analyzed on Guildline model 8410 Portasal Salinometers which are standardized with IAPSO standard seawater. Oxygen samples are analyzed on an automated Winkler titration system following the procedures of Carpenter (1965). A Brinkmann model 665 Dosimat and model PC910 Colorimeter is controlled by Visual-Basic program to titrate the oxygen samples. Nutrient samples are analyzed frozen using a Technicon AAII autoanalyzer following methods described in Barwell-Clarke and Whitney (1996). Chlorophyll samples are collected in duplicate in calibrated polycarbonate bottles (~330ml), then filtered onto 25mm MFS GF/75 filters at <70mmHg vacuum. The filters are placed in glass scintillation vials and immediately frozen at -20ºC until analysis. The chlorophyll is extracted in 10 ml of 90% acetone for 24h at -20ºC, then brought to room temperature and the extract is decanted and measured using a Turner Designs 10-AU-005-CE fluorometer, which has been calibrated with solutions of commercially prepared chlorophyll.
